A sample of solution has a volume of 2.50 mL and a mass of 7.50 g. What is the density?

Respuesta :

jennt90 jennt90
  • 17-12-2020

Answer:

3

Explanation:

density= mass/ volume

d= 7.50/2.50 which equals 3
